PRODUCTS
What are your models made from?

Each piece is cast from a high-detail micro concrete mix — developed after years of testing. It uses fine particles and quick-set cement for crisp detailing, along with additives to improve flow and strength. There’s no generic concrete product here — the mix is handmade, just like everything else.

 

How do you design your models?

I begin with in-depth research into the building’s architecture and history — collecting blueprints, historical photographs, and any references I can find. If I can visit the site, I will document it myself.

Then I create a 2D digital drawing, followed by a detailed 3D digital model, built from the ground up using architectural software. It’s part research, part sculpture — balancing precision with artistic expression to capture the spirit of the building in miniature form.

 

How are the models made physically?

Once the design is complete, I use resin 3D printing to produce a master model. This technique builds the model layer by micro-layer in liquid resin, using UV light. It’s a complex, finicky process with plenty of trial and error — especially because I’m printing at the limits of what resin can achieve.

From there, I make a silicone mould around the print, using a careful pouring and pressure-chamber process to ensure the mould captures every last detail.

 

Why do you use a pressure chamber?

Both the silicone mould and the concrete casting go through pressurisation to eliminate air bubbles and preserve the sharpest details possible. This is part of what makes my models feel so crisp and clean — even when they’re tiny.

How long does each model take to make?

Each model takes several days from start to finish — not including the months of research, testing, and design development that go into each new building. I also only cast in small batches, and every model is finished by hand, sanded, checked, and set on a custom laser-etched cork base.

 

Are the models sealed or treated?

No sealants are added — I leave the raw concrete exposed so you can appreciate its natural texture and patina. Each piece will slowly age and wear over time, just like the buildings they represent.
